Output e0834eb573507336ff0409239e731d91e3f4997884f59c8428c3568bd4c5eaa8:1

value
135267284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dbca82ee90a79c38cdf13a5374c8a20bfd53f88 OP_EQUAL
address
32wei9r4qgnjwUb7z81j8MKoxp1dkNmJ2t
transaction
e0834eb573507336ff0409239e731d91e3f4997884f59c8428c3568bd4c5eaa8
spent
true